Each ELEMENT in a driven array antenna RECEIVES RF energy from the transmission LINE, and different arrangements of the ELEMENTS produce different degrees of directivity and gain. The THREE basic types of driven arrays are the collinear, the broadside, and the end-i re. A fourth type is the wide-bandwidth log-periodic antenna.
